Breno Arsioli Moura – Science & Education, 2024
In 1752, the American polymath Benjamin Franklin supposedly flew a kite near the city of Philadelphia, Pennsylvania, to confirm that lightning had the same properties of common electricity that electrical machines produced and Leyden jars served to store. Turner, Steven C. – Science & Education, 2012
Between 1880 and 1920 the way science was taught in American High Schools changed dramatically. The old "lecture/demonstration" method, where information was presented to essentially passive students, was replaced by the "laboratory" method, where students performed their own experiments in specially constructed student laboratories.
